Here in Cancun, there is a big problem with trust, many Americans run here when in trouble with the law up north.  I have been taken in by charm and smooth manners before, only to discover the snake underneath.  I am very careful who I share information with now, especially with newcomers to town who offer a less than believable answer for why they are here.  I don't become friends with someone just because they are a foreigner, it's far more about common interests and attitudes.  &lt;BR/&gt;&lt;BR/&gt;I do have to say that almost 100% of my "real life" friends here came about as the result of an online forum for ex-pats.  An online personality is not necessarily a good reflection of the real person, but I can weed out the people that quite obviously have different attitudes and behaviours than I and have found some people with whom I share a great deal.
